Time travel into the past would be extremely dangerous. Your mere presence there could, and would, set off a chain reaction of events that, though seemingly unnoticeable, would change the course of history. After all, history is a web of billions of interactions stacked upon each other like dominoes. Remove, or even nudge, one domino, and an entire series of events will unfold differently. What might feel like a harmless gesture could completely erase the world you came from and replace it with something unrecognizable.
